In 1837, Victoria became Queen of the United Kingdom and ruled for 63 years. During the so-called Victorian era, Britain's empire became the biggest in the world. The Industrial Revolution transformed Britain into a technological powerhouse, and the population skyrocketed. WebFeb 3, 2024 · Victoria has a much cooler climate than Australia’s northern states, which means it looks extra green compared to the rest of the country. Leafy national parks like Wilsons Promontory, the Grampians, Mount Buffalo and the Yarra Ranges supply some of the best bushwalking terrain anywhere in the country. We accept commissions from across the UK for projects requiring specialist plaster … WebMar 28, 2024 · The Folk Victorian style house is the most common type of home found in the US. This style gained popularity in the 19th century and was considered as a more affordable alternative to Queen Anne style of design. The architects of Folk Victorian style houses simply created a pimped-up version of a Victorian house using cheaper materials …
